numpy.ma.maximum_fill_value(obj)
[source] -
Return the minimum value that can be represented by the dtype of an object.
This function is useful for calculating a fill value suitable for taking the maximum of an array with a given dtype.
Parameters: obj : {ndarray, dtype}
An object that can be queried for it?s numeric type.
Returns: val : scalar
The minimum representable value.
Raises: TypeError
If
obj
isn?t a suitable numeric type.See also
